Frequently Asked Questions

The schedule isn't showing any events.

The app fetches parking restriction data directly from the publicly available City of Evanston website. If no events appear, either the City hasn't posted upcoming restrictions yet, or your network is blocking the request.

Pull down on the schedule to refresh. If the issue persists on Wi-Fi and cellular, it's likely that no events have been listed for upcoming dates.

My notifications aren't arriving.

Check that notifications are enabled for this app in your device's Settings → Notifications. On iOS, make sure "Allow Notifications" is turned on. Notifications are delivered locally by your device — no internet connection is required.

Also confirm the reminder was set: tap the bell icon next to the event and verify your chosen lead time appears highlighted.

The parking restriction times seem wrong.

Restriction start times are calculated as 2 hours before the listed event start, consistent with standard City of Evanston District 6 enforcement. For example, a 7:00 PM kickoff means parking restrictions begin at 5:00 PM.

Always verify against the official City of Evanston source before making any parking decisions.

How do I cancel a reminder I set?

Tap the purple bell icon next to the event. A confirmation prompt will appear — tap Remove Reminder to cancel all notifications for that event.

Does the app work without an internet connection?

Yes — after the first successful load, schedule data is cached on your device and available offline. The cache is refreshed automatically roughly once a month, or whenever you manually pull to refresh.

Troubleshooting steps

  1. Pull down on the schedule screen to force a fresh data refresh.
  2. Check Settings → Notifications → NU Stadium Guest Parking Alert — ensure notifications are allowed.
  3. Verify the event bell icon shows your selected reminder time (highlighted purple).
  4. Confirm your device's time zone matches the event's local time (America/Chicago).
  5. If nothing resolves the issue, delete and reinstall the app to reset local state.
